Castanets, a two-key oboe or a fan with a dance scene. All of the above are objects that we can see from yesterday in the free exhibition Echoes of the Baroque. The soundtrack of Goyeneche’s Madrid, which brings us closer to the music that was listened to in the 18th century, the time of the founder of Nuevo Baztán: Juan de Goyeneche.
Through multiple documents and other pieces to which the public does not normally have access -such as scores, instruments, treatises, librettos, fans, costumes, engravings or plans- a landscape is drawn in which music was always present: in the theater and in churches, but also in streets, squares and in palatial and domestic rooms.
It was also present at celebrations, whether they were of a courtly, processional, religious, military, civil or popular nature. That is why it will not be missing during the tour: the music of the time will accompany the public during this journey through the best of a Baroque that was already in the process of changing to other styles.

The musical library of Madrid
Music lovers have a real temple in Chamberí: the Biblioteca Musical Víctor Espinós, a place where they lend instruments for free and where you can reserve rehearsal rooms, but where they also organize concerts and exhibitions.
